Our Mission

The Lu Group at Shenzhen Bay Laboratory is dedicated to developing cutting-edge theoretical and computational methods to understand quantum phenomena in chemical and biological systems.

Our research bridges the gap between fundamental electronic structure theory and practical applications in photochemistry, catalysis, and quantum biology. We strive to create methods that are both rigorous and computationally efficient, enabling simulations of complex systems that were previously intractable.

We believe in open science and collaboration. Our methods are implemented in open-source software packages, and we actively collaborate with experimental groups around the world to validate and apply our theoretical predictions.

Shenzhen Bay Laboratory

深圳湾实验室 (SZBL) is a provincial laboratory established in 2019, focused on life sciences and information technology. Located in the heart of China's innovation hub, SZBL brings together researchers from around the world to tackle fundamental challenges in biology and medicine.
